Transaction 64b5e91b34993353cb11bc1b74a9ddf86b1c378d32269e2676d4930592796417
1 Input
1 Output
-
64b5e91b34993353cb11bc1b74a9ddf86b1c378d32269e2676d4930592796417:0
- value
- 18698009
- script pubkey
- OP_0 OP_PUSHBYTES_20 0ca713dde34ceb4a426f1d42f5f7b87ccdd93ced
- address
- bc1qpjn38h0rfn455sn0r4p0taac0nxaj08d50kkfm